THE COMMANDANT OF THE UNITED STATES COAST GUARD WASHINGTON 20593 JUL 29:'lrl'r The Commandant of the United States Coast Guard takes pleasure in presenting the COAST GUARD MERITORIOUS TEAM COMMENDATION to: COAST GUARD STATION CHINCOTEAGUE CHINCOTEAGUE, VIRGINIA for service as set forth in the following CITATION: rrFor exceptionally meritorious service from March 2008 through July 2008 while providing for the maritime safety and security of Chincoteague Island's 83'd Annual Pony Swim. In preparation, Station Chincoteague identified the vast scope of this event and formed a diverse interagency team comprised of members from Sector Hampton Roads sub-units, Coast Guard Auxiliary Division 12 and District Five Waterways Management. This team distinguished themselves in preparing for and overseeing the safe execution of this internationally renowned event which drew nearly 501000 visitors. Based on past experience of the high probability of mariners engaging in illegal chartering, Station Chincoteague personnel developed a compressive preventative strategy, including a timely education program and implemented a collaborative effort to identify, prevent, detect and suppress violations. This educational community outreach included initiatives such as public town hall meetings, radio broadcasts, meetings with local business owners and walking the docks the morning of the event handing out safety pamphlets. In concert with the Virginia Marine Resource Commission, the Virginia Department of Game and Inland Fisheries and District Five Waterways Management, Station Chincoteague personnel formed an interagency team with the town of Chincoteague, which proved crucial to the overall success of the event. The first ever establishment of a localized, three-day 'Slow Speed Zone' resulted in the most well'organized entry and departure of over 300 vessels in recent memory. Additionally, in the midst of ensuring the safety of the boating public and the ponies, Station Chincoteague personnel assisted the Virginia Marine Resource Commission with security for the Governor of Virginia's visit to the Pony Swim. Station Chincoteague's persistent efforts achieved outstanding results, providing for a safe maritime event, widely lauded the best Pony Swim since its inception in 1925. The dedication, prideo and professionalism displayed try Station Chincoteague are in keeping with the highest traditions of the United States Coast Guard.rr The Operational Distinguishing Device is authorized.
